Set in the beautiful Serra de São Mamede Natural Park near the historic village of Marvão, Quinta do Maral is a small scale naturist retreat surrounded by ten hectares of unspoilt nature. Rolling hills, olive groves and spectacular views define the landscape.
The atmosphere is warm and welcoming. The owners share not only their passion for naturism but also their love for this remarkable region. Respect, freedom and connection with nature are at the heart of every stay.
The campsite features spacious shaded pitches, unique accommodation options and nature trails that cross the property. Dedicated meditation areas provide the perfect setting to slow down and reconnect with yourself.
Seasonal activities include yoga sessions, birdwatching, workshops and cosy campfire evenings. During cooler months, guests can unwind in the welcoming bar with regional drinks, local liqueurs and a crackling fireplace.
You can stay with your own tent, caravan or motorhome, or choose one of the charming camping pods, caravans or nature inspired accommodations available on site.
The surrounding area is a paradise for walkers and outdoor enthusiasts. Marked hiking trails lead through forests, valleys and panoramic viewpoints rich in wildlife and native plants. Cycling and horseback riding are also popular activities.
Visit the stunning hilltop village of Marvão, explore the charming streets of Castelo de Vide or discover the ancient Roman city of Ammaia. Nearby rivers and lakes offer opportunities for swimming, canoeing or simply enjoying the peaceful scenery.

Located near Marvão, the highest point in Alentejo, Quinta do Maral offers a glimpse into traditional Portuguese life, where locals farm their land and raise animals. The area is known for its goat cheese, olives, wine, and cork production. A visit to Marvão (4 km), one of the most picturesque villages in Alentejo, is a must. Enjoy a traditional lunch at a local restaurant, and explore the area via hiking, biking, or climbing routes. Birdwatching is also popular here. Nearby attractions include reservoirs (16 km away) and the Sierra de São Mamede Nature Park. Amenities such as ATMs, restaurants, gyms, and a bus stop are approximately 4 km from the campsite.
